+// proxy api test
+// browser_tests.exe --gtest_filter=ProxySettingsApiTest.ProxyEventsInvalidProxy
+
+var expected_error = {
+ error: "net::ERR_PROXY_CONNECTION_FAILED",
+ details: "",
+ fatal: true
+};
+var empty_json_url = "";
+
+function test() {
+ // Install error handler and get the test server config.
+ chrome.proxy.onProxyError.addListener(function (error) {
+ chrome.test.assertEq(expected_error, error);
+ chrome.test.notifyPass();
+ });
+ chrome.test.getConfig(readConfigAndSetProxy);
+}
+
+function readConfigAndSetProxy(test_config) {
+ // Construct the URL used for XHRs and set the proxy settings.
+ empty_json_url = "http://127.0.0.1:" +
+ test_config.testServer.port +
+ "/files/extensions/api_test/proxy/events/empty.json";
+
+ // Set an invalid proxy and fire of a XHR. This should trigger proxy errors.
+ // There may be any number of proxy errors, as systems like safe browsing
+ // might start network traffic as well.
+ var rules = {
+ singleProxy: { host: "does.not.exist" }
+ };
+ var config = { rules: rules, mode: "fixed_servers" };
+ chrome.proxy.settings.set({'value': config}, sendFailingXHR);
+}
+
+function sendFailingXHR() {
+ var req = new XMLHttpRequest();
+ req.open("GET", empty_json_url, true);
+ req.onload = function () {
+ chrome.test.notifyFail("proxy settings should not work");
+ }
+ req.onerror = testDone;
+ req.send(null);
+}
+
+function testDone() {
+ // Do nothing. The test success/failure is decided in the event handler.
+}
+
+test();
